The aim of this course is to provide students with skills in the analysis of images and digital video sequences. In a first part they will understand the ways in which information can be extracted from images: automatic detection of characteristic elements, shape and color descriptions. This information will then be used to compare different images based on common elements (these skills will allow the student to automatically group perceptually similar images or to estimate from images the depth of a scene). Finally, algorithms for motion identification and analysis will be designed (possible applications of these techniques involve the representation and understanding of human motion).
